TREMONT — Leota M. Springer, 97, formerly of Tremont, passed away at 4:50 a.m. Wednesday (May 25, 2016) at Maple Lawn Care Center, Eureka.
She was born Jan. 10, 1919, in Gridley, to Silas D. and Amanda Stalter Birkey. She married Paul Springer on March 15, 1945, in Morton. He passed away Aug. 15, 1994.
Surviving are three sons, Gail (Linda) Springer, Ross (Cheri) Springer and Ryan (Kirsten) Springer, all of Tremont; two daughters, Rita Nesbit, Normal, and Roma (Dr. Greg) Popp, Jefferson City, Mo.; 16 grandchildren; 15 great-grandchildren; one great-great-grandson; three sisters, Velda Birky, Hopedale; Norma (Merle) Nafziger and Joan (John) Litwiller, both of Minier; and one sister-in-law, Florence Birkey of Flanagan.
She was preceded in death by her parents; one son, Gary; one infant sister, Aldine; two sisters, Marie Oyer and Carolyn Kutzner; one brother, Lowell Birkey; one grandson, John Wilham; one great-granddaughter, Shelby Lanan; and one niece, Cindy Kutzner.
Leota was a homemaker.
She was a member of Hopedale Mennonite Church, its Mennonite Women, and was the church historian for many years. She also volunteered at the Et Cetera Shop in Eureka for many years.
She enjoyed scrapbooking, quilting and photo albums.
Her funeral will be at noon Saturday at Hopedale Mennonite Church. Pastors Kurt Walker and Roger Springer will officiate. Visitation will be from 9 to 11:45 a.m. Saturday, also at the church. Burial will be in Mennonite Cemetery, Hopedale. Davis-Oswald Funeral Home, Hopedale, is handling the arrangements.
Memorials may be made to her church or Advocate at Home Hospice, Bloomington.
